The NPSG included the following measurements: * Chest and abdominal wall movement by respiratory impedance or inductance plethysmography * Heart rate by ECG * Airflow with sidestream end-tidal carbon dioxide levels * Pulse oximetric saturation (SpO2) and waveform bilateral electrooculogram * Eight-channel EEG * Chin and anterior tibial EMG * Body position All measurements were digitized and tracheal sound was monitored with a microphone sensor.
